Seasonal marketing also works well for service businesses, not only products. Services can match offers to seasonal needs and problems people face. For example, cleaning, training, or repair services fit certain periods. The message should explain how the service helps during that season. Simple discounts or limited packages can attract attention. Educational content also builds trust when sales are slow. Services benefit from showing value instead of pushing prices.
